Folding

Folding in an online poker game is a crucial decision that can make or break a player’s fortune. It is because when you fold, you’re essentially saying that you don’t have the cards to compete and are willing to give up your chance at the pot.

Although at the same time, whenever you are folding strategically, you can conserve your chips and bankroll to avoid high-risk situations. You can also use it as an opportunity to wait for a better hand to come along.
